VPS真的会占用大量内存吗?_全面解析VPS内存使用与优化技巧

VPS会占用多少内存资源?如何优化VPS内存使用?

VPS配置 内存占用情况 适用场景
1GB 基础服务约300-500MB 个人博客、小型网站
2GB 中等负载约1-1.5GB 中小型应用、开发环境
4GB 高负载约2-3.5GB 数据库、企业级应用
8GB+ 根据应用需求动态分配 大型系统、高并发场景

VPS内存使用全面解析

VPS(Virtual Private Server)作为一种虚拟化服务器技术,确实会占用内存资源。内存使用量主要取决于以下几个因素:
  1. 操作系统基础占用:Linux系统通常需要300-500MB内存,Windows系统则需要更多
  2. 运行服务数量:每项服务(如Web服务器、数据库等)都会增加内存消耗
  3. 应用程序需求:不同软件对内存的要求差异很大
  4. 并发连接数:高并发场景会显著增加内存使用

内存优化方法

1. 选择合适配置

根据实际需求选择VPS配置,避免资源浪费或不足。建议预留20%内存余量。

2. 轻量级系统选择

使用精简版Linux发行版(如Alpine Linux)可减少基础内存占用。

3. 服务优化

  • 禁用不必要的后台服务
  • 调整服务配置参数(如PHP-FPM进程数)
  • 使用内存缓存工具(如Redis)

4. 监控工具

安装监控工具实时掌握内存使用情况:
# 安装htop监控工具
sudo apt-get install htop

常见问题解决方案

问题现象 可能原因 解决方案
VPS频繁卡顿 内存不足 升级配置或优化服务
服务自动重启 内存溢出 检查日志并调整参数
响应速度慢 内存泄漏 更新软件版本
无法启动新服务 内存耗尽 终止不必要进程

通过合理配置和优化,VPS的内存使用可以得到有效控制。建议定期检查内存使用情况,并根据业务发展及时调整资源配置。

发表评论

评论列表